Grief (iamgrief) wrote :

As a workaround, it is possible to try AT YOUR OWN RISK:
1. sudo dpkg -r fpc-src
2. sudo apt-get -f install

This helped me to continue the upgrade from 14.04 to 14.10.

Paul Gevers (paul-climbing) wrote :

Thank you for taking the time to report this bug and trying to help make Ubuntu better. However, it seems that you are not using a software package provided by the official Ubuntu repositories. Because of this the Ubuntu project can not support or fix your particular bug. Please report this bug to the provider of the software package. Thanks!

If you are interested in learning more about software repositories and Ubuntu, check https://help.ubuntu.com/community/Repositories

In this particular case, there is no package called fpc-src in Ubuntu, so you need to remove it before you can install the package. Grief in msg #3 gave an example, I would have said:
sudo apt-get remove fpc-src
sudo apt-get install fpc-source
